Mexico’s navy arrested 35 police officers, including four women, on Saturday for alleged links with the Zetas drug cartel. Meanwhile, Mexican President-Elect Enrique Peña Nieto on the last leg of his international tour met with Peruvian President Ollanta Humala this weekend. Their focus was on a joint trade relationship. In Brazil, more than 500 protested a recent anti-Islam film on Saturday. Christian and Jewish supporters marched peacefully alongside Muslims in Sao Paolo. And Cuba wraps its first census in 10 years with 9 million participants.
